本文目录一览:

excel排班表模板

先依照下图,填上每月的一号和星期一,部门员工名字

填充日期(1-31号)

选中日期1,可以看到单元格右下角有个实心小点。鼠标放在这个小点上,指针会变成实心加号的形状。

然后拖住鼠标左键往右侧拖拉,点击下拉菜单,选【填充序列】,效果如图

填充星期

填充方式和填充日期的一致,下拉菜单中【填充序列】和【以天数填充】效果一样,就是1234567,如选择【以工作日填充】,效果就是周一到周五循环。

调整excel表格的宽度

可以复制或在依照上面的方法,为员工批量添加白班和休息日期。

这时候表格样式看着不顺眼,每个单元格太宽,要批量调整的话,全选需要调整的列,然后鼠标放在任意两列中间,指针会变成双箭头的样式(我截不了图,手工画一个意思一下)。然后双击,就可以把这些列的宽度调整成一样了。

修正表头为居中对齐

选中表头“排班表”所在行,点击【合并后居中】即可。

调整表格高度

参照“调整excel表格的宽度”的方法调整宽度,最终得出排班表。

如何用Excel制作倒班排班表

1,以Excel2007为例,打开Excel表格。

2,设置日期、部门、姓名、电话等项,这就需要看你需要哪些了,可以自由添加其他选项,如图所示

3表格制作完成以后,给表格加边框,如图所示

4,在表格中把日期、部门、姓名等等都填上,如图所示

5,有时候需要调节行高和行款,如图所示,点击调整

6,表格行高以及宽度都设置好了,如图所示

7,表格里字体根据图中所示,可以随意调整大小及字体,如图所示

Excel怎么用公式来排值班表,以下图为例?

先随机生成整数选择RANDBEWEEN函数,保证数距的随机性,数值设置到1-5然后在第一个姓名单元格中输入公式为【=CHOOSE(RANDBETWEEN(1,5),"张磊","革命","留种","彩虹","小强")】

如何Excel用制作自动排班表

把问题作为内容(邮件主题一定要包含“excel”,本人以此为依据辨别非垃圾邮件,以免误删),excel样表文件(把现状和目标效果表示出来)作为附件发来看下

yqch134@163.com

用excel表格做排班表的方法步骤详解

Excel 是三大办公软件之一的一个软件,他经常用于数据的整理、分析、以及对比等。而有很多时候需要用到Excel里的图表功能进行制作排班表。下面是我带来的关于用excel做排班表教程的内容,欢迎阅读!

用excel做排班表的 方法

01.打开“轮休排班表”原始文件,在C3单元格中输入“2012-11-1”,然后在“开始”选项卡下的“编辑”组中单击“填充”按钮,在弹出的下拉列表中单击“系列”选项。

02.打开“序列”对话框,选择在“序列产生在“组合框中选择“行”单选项;在“类型”组合框中选择“日期”单选项;在“日期单位”组合框中选择“日”单选项;在“终止值”文本框中输入“2012-11-30”,然后单击“确认”按钮。

03.单元格将以行填充日期数,选择单元格“C3:AF3”区域,在“开始”选项卡下单击“数字”组中的“功能扩展”按钮。

04.打开“设置单元格”格式对话框,在“数字”选项卡下单击“自定义”选项,在“类型”文本框中输入“d”,然后单击“确定”按钮。

05.所选单元格中日期格式将更改为指定格式,然后在“开始”选项卡下单击“格式”按钮,在弹出的菜单中单击“自动调整列宽”选项。

06.在C2单元格中根据日期录入星期数,然后使用自动填充功能将其填充至单元格AF2,并在单元格“B4:B19”输入相关数据内容,然后选中单元格“C4:AF19”区域,在“数据”选项卡下单击“数据有效性”按钮。

07打开“数据有效性”对话框,将“有效性条件”组合框的“允许”下拉列表数据设置为“序列”,然后单击“来源”文本框右侧的折叠按钮。

08.选中单元格“B22:B23”,然后单击“数据有效性”对话框中的展开按钮。

09.展开“数据有效性”对话框,切换到“输入信息”选项卡,在输入信息文本框中输入“√出勤、●休假”,然后单击“确定”按钮。

10.此时单元格区域“A2:E10”中将显示数据有效性相关设置,选中单元格C4,切换到视图选项卡,然后单击“冻结窗口”按钮,在展开的下拉列表中选择“冻结首列”选项。

11.C4单元格左侧的单元格将被锁定在屏幕中,滚动水平滚动条,即可查看相关效果,然后对单元格“A1:AM20”区域进行格式设置,并为其添加底纹和边框,最终效果如图。

下一页更多精彩“ex

var _hmt = _hmt || []; (function() { var hm = document.createElement("script"); hm.src = ""; var s = document.getElementsByTagName("script")[0]; s.parentNode.insertBefore(hm, s); })();